Nancy Zeman is a native of the Midwest, born and raised in Paris, Ill. She is a retired newspaper publisher/editor/reporter, having founded The Prairie Press in Paris in 2014 to better serve her community. She is a graduate of Indiana State University and had the privilege of watching Larry Bird play. While her profession is journalism, she and her late husband, Don Zeman, were owners of “Homefront with Don Zeman”, a nationally syndicated home improvement radio television show. After his sudden death in 2008, Nancy went to work for Chick-fil-A in marketing. She directed high school drama in her hometown for 12 years as well as middle school drama for five years. She’s not the best singer, but she enjoys her time with the Anson Singers and currently is the stage manager for the Uwharrie Players upcoming musical “Once Upon a Mattress”.
